God
God's promises are like the stars; the darker the night the brighter they shine.
- David Nicholas
God is a comedian playing to an audience too afraid to laugh.
- Voltaire
God first created light, all men are born out of it. The whole world came out of a single spark; who is good and who is bad? The Creator is in the creation, and the creation in the Creator, He is everywhere…He who surrenders to Him gets to know Him. God is invisible, He cannot be seen. The Guru has granted me this sweet gift. My doubts are dispelled. I have seen the Pure with my own eyes.
- A Spiritual Leader
God does not test you because he knows you completely - your past, present and future.
- Sri Sri Ravi Shankar
God Himself told me that the most basic and central truth of the universe is that God is the Father and we are His children. We are all created as children of God.
- Sun Myung Moon
A man is truly free, even here in this embodied state, if he knows that God is the true agent and he by himself is powerless to do anything.
- Ramakrishna Paramahamsa
The best reply to an atheist is to give him a good dinner and ask him if he believes there is a cook.
- Louis Nizer
The Self-realised soul can impart knowledge unto you and when you have thus learned the truth, you will know that all living beings are but a part of Me-and that they are in Me, and are Mine.
- Srimad Bhagavad Gita
Only by doing good can one benefit. Those who detach themselves from ‘bad’ and yearn for ‘good’, dedicate their lives to God…and to service of scholars shall be blessed.
- Vedas
To work without attachment is to work without the expectation of reward or fear of any punishment in this world or the next. Work so done is a means to the end, and God is the end.
- Ramakrishna Paramahamsa
